Pune, Jan 6: Senior Congress leader and former union minister Suresh Kalmadi passed away in Pune early Tuesday following a prolonged illness, family sources said. He was 81.
Kalmadi breathed his last at around 3.30 am, the sources said.
A prominent political figure from Pune, Kalmadi had served as Union Minister of State for Railways and was a former president of the Indian Olympic Association (IOA). He represented Pune multiple times in the Lok Sabha and held several key positions during his long political career. He was also closely associated with sports administration at the national level for many years.

Leaders cutting across party lines expressed grief over his demise and paid tribute to his contributions to public life.
Kalmadi is survived by his wife, a son and daughter-in-law, two married daughters and a son-in-law, and grandchildren.
His mortal remains will be kept at Kalmadi House in the Erandwane area till 2 pm. The cremation will be held at Vaikunth crematorium in Navi Peth at 3.30 pm.
